Job Description
Provides the highest quality age-appropriate care for patients newborn to 20 years of age within the scope of practice and established standards for occupational therapy. Functions effectively as a member of the rehabilitation team. Supports the mission of Childrens Healthcare of Atlanta. Proactively supports efforts that ensure delivery of safe patient care and services and promote a safe environment at Children's Healthcare of Atlanta.Experience
- Experience in entry level
Preferred Qualifications
- 1 year of experience in pediatric or related occupational therapy
Education
- Bachelor of Science, Masters degree, or Doctorate degree in Occupational Therapy from an accredited school
Certification Summary
- Georgia occupational therapy license
- Basic Life Support (BLS) within 30 days of employment
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ities
- Knowledge of pediatric theory and practice
- Excellent oral and written communication skills for effective communication of information
- Positive interpersonal skills and ability to function in an interdisciplinary environment
- Must be able to successfully pass the Basic Windows Assessment at 80% or higher rating within 30 days of employment
- Travel to other Childrens Healthcare of Atlanta locations based on patient census, program development, and/or contract obligations with physician practices
Job Responsibilities
- Evaluates patients, meeting established standards.
- Plans and implements effective and appropriate treatment so that functional outcomes are achieved.
- Completes documentation, meeting departmental standards for content, accuracy, and timeliness.
- Includes family/caregiver in patient care and provides effective education and documentation appropriate for learning needs of patient and family.
- Provides supervision to Certified Occupational Therapy Assistants and Rehabilitation Aides as assigned.
- Demonstrates competencies that incorporate age-specific guidelines, including N = Neonate (less than 30 days), I = Infant (30 days to 1 year), EC = Early Childhood (1-5 years), LC = Late Childhood (5-13 years), A = Adolescent (13-17 years), AD = Adult, and ALL = all ages.
